Oral health is a vital part of individuals's total health. States are called for to provide oral benefits to children covered by Medicaid and the Kid's Health and wellness Insurance coverage Program (CHIP), however mentions choose whether to give dental benefits for grownups.


The Main Principles Of Dental Innovations




Oral screening might be part of a physical test, it does not substitute for a dental examination executed by a dental expert. A referral to a dentist is needed for each youngster in conformity with the periodicity routine established by a state. Dental solutions for youngsters must minimally consist of: Relief of pain and infectionsRestoration of teethMaintenance of oral healthThe EPSDT advantage calls for that all solutions have to this link be given if determined medically needed.


If a problem requiring treatment is found throughout a testing, the state has to provide the essential services to deal with that condition, whether such services are consisted of in a state's Medicaid plan. Each state is called for to develop a dental periodicity schedule in examination with identified dental organizations entailed in kid health treatment.

States must talk to identified oral organizations associated with child health care to establish those periods (http://go.bubbl.us/e1d2f2/e0af?/New-Mind-Map). A recommendation to a dental expert is required for each child based on each State's periodicity schedule and at other periods as medically needed. The periodicity timetable for various other EPSDT services might not control the schedule for dental services

Dental coverage in different CHIP programs is needed to include insurance coverage for oral solutions "necessary to stop illness and promote oral health, recover oral structures to health and function, and deal with emergency problems."States with a different CHIP program may select from 2 choices for giving dental insurance coverage: a plan of oral benefits that satisfies the CHIP demands, or a benchmark dental advantage package.

States are additionally required to publish a listing of all getting involved Medicaid and CHIP dental carriers and advantage plans on . States have flexibility to establish what dental advantages are offered to adult Medicaid enrollees. While most states give at the very least emergency situation oral solutions for adults, much less than fifty percent of the states currently provide extensive oral care.




The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Provider (CMS) is dedicated to enhancing accessibility to oral and oral wellness solutions for recipients signed up in Medicaid and CHIP. In 2010, CMS established an Oral Health Effort (OHI) to boost kids's access to appropriate preventive dental care by functioning with states, government companions, the dental service provider community, and supporters.


In 2023, CMS assembled a professional workgroup to provide input on critical concerns for the following phase of the OHI. The workgroup advised that CMS widen the OHI to deal with dental health and wellness accessibility, quality, and results throughout the life-span, with a focus on: boosting a focus on preventative, minimally invasive, and timely treatment; boosting taken care of care plan involvement and accountability; andenhancing ability for top quality dimension and information analytics.
